Mercury India Certification Frequently Asked Questions

1. How often are Mercury Product Certification Exams conducted in India?
Once per quarter.


2. What exams are available to take in India?
The following Mercury product exams are available: QuickTest Pro, WinRunner, TestDirector, and LoadRunner.


3. What types of exams are available?

The CPC (Certified Product Consultant) and the Specialist exam.

The CPC exam is an advanced Certification Exam designed for people with a least 1 year experience with Mercury products, who may wish to be a Mercury Product Consultant.

The Specialist exam is designed for new users of the product who wish to demonstrate their mastery of the product.


4. What are the prerequisites for taking the exam?
We recommend the following:

1.

A working knowledge on Mercury products. At least 1 year for CPC exams and 3-6 months for Specialist exams.

2.

The completion of Mercury product training courses in the product you wish to take a Certification exam for.


5. How do I enroll in an exam and what is the exam Process?

1.

Enroll with Mercury for the Specialist or CPC exam and pay the exam fee. Enrollment form will be made available by Mercury.

2.

You will be notified two weeks prior to exam and provide the following details:

a)

Exam policy

b)

Study Guides

c)

Exam venue

d)

Installation process

3.

Next we will schedule your examination date.

4.

A Mercury Certification expert will contact participants for assessment on test preparedness a week after sending exam instructions to participant.

5.

Examination fees are approximately US$ 700 for Product Specialist & US$ 2500 for CPC

6.

The Certification Exam will then be Proctored by a Mercury Certification representative.

7.

A score of at least 70% must be attained to “Pass” the exam.

8.

Upon the grading of your exam results, an official Mercury Certification pack will be forwarded to you via post within 2 weeks.

Acquiring the designation of Certified Software Quality Analyst (CSQA) indicates a professional level of competence in the principles and practices of quality assurance in the IT profession.Common Body of Knowledge

This certification requires candidates to demonstrate skills in the following Categories:


1. Quality Principles and Concepts
2. Quality Leadership
3. Quality Baselines (Assessments and Models
4. Quality Assurance
5. Quality Planning
6. Define, Build, Implement and Improve Work Processes
7. Quality Control Practices
8. Metrics and Measrurement
9. Internal Control and Security
10. Outsourcing, COTS and Contracting Quality
